Lets look at the past history of the Wings as goalie "Kingmakers". In '95, it was "who the f**k was Martin Brodeuer", until he stoned what had been the most outstanding offensive club since Gretzky's Oilers. In '03, it was "who the f**k is Sebastian Giguere?", until he swept the Wings out of the playoffs with a series of 1-0 and 2-1 wins...on their way to a finals appearance. Kiprusoff followed in '04. Where was his playoff sucess before Detroit??? Hopefully Ellis' "legend" won't be created in the next 48 hours. If so, we can create a Mt. Rushmore of goaltenders who have done the most to destroy what would have been an amazing 13 year dynasty with potentially 7 hoistings of Lord Stanleys Cup.

Oh yeah...Arturs Irbe in '94...SCREW HIM TOO!!!!
